Eruptions can also shatter the solid rock of the magma chamber and volcanic … Web29 de out. de 2024 · Rocks can affect the atmosphere! Tiny particles of ash help make raindrops in the atmosphere as water condenses around them. The gases released from volcanoes can become sulfuric acid droplets that screen out sunlight.
